Ron DeSantis, other Florida officials hit with class action lawsuit by migrants flown to Massachusetts
Gov. DeSantis flew migrants to Martha’s Vineyard last week as part of his pledge to send illegal immigrants to progressive states
By Bradford Betz | Fox News

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is and other state officials are facing a class action lawsuit filed by migrants who were flown to Massachusetts last week.

The case, filed in the District of Massachusetts Tuesday, names the State of Florida, the Department of Transportation, its secretary, Jared W. Perdue, as well as the governor – both in their official and personal capacities.

The lawsuit alleges that DeSantis and his others "designed and executed a premediated, fraudulent, and illegal scheme centered on exploiting this vulnerability for the sole purpose of advancing their own personal, financial and political interests."

The lawsuit alleges that unidentified "Doe Defendants," collaborating with the named defendants, identified and targeted class members by "trolling streets outside of a migrant shelter in Texas and other similar locales, pretending to be good Samaritans offering humanitarian assistance."

DeSantis Has Receipts That Pokes Major Holes In Migrant Class Action Lawsuit
Julio Rosas
Posted: Sep 20, 2022 8:10 PM

Florida Governor Ron DeSantis' office responded to the class action lawsuit filed on behalf of the migrants flown to Martha's Vineyard by immigration lawyers and activists by showing the migrants signed consent forms.

The lawsuit claims the flights were "a premeditated, fraudulent, and illegal scheme centered on exploiting [the migrants] for the sole purpose of advancing their own personal, financial and political interests."

"It is opportunistic that activists would use illegal immigrants for political theater. If these activists spent even a fraction of this time and effort at the border, perhaps some accountability would be brought to the Biden Administration’s reckless border policies that entice illegal immigrants to make dangerous and often lethal journeys through Central America and put their lives in the hands of cartels and Coyotes," said DeSantis' office on Tuesday.

"The transportation of the immigrants to Martha’s Vineyard was done on a voluntary basis. The immigrants were homeless, hungry, and abandoned – and these activists didn’t care about them then," the statement continued. "Florida’s program gave them a fresh start in a sanctuary state and these individuals opted to take advantage of chartered flights to Massachusetts. It was disappointing that Martha’s Vineyard called in the Massachusetts National Guard to bus them away from the island within 48 hours."

Townhall was provided with a photo of a consent form showing the information given to the person who signed it was in English and Spanish. The person then wrote they would be leaving Texas and arriving in Massachusetts, highlighting the fact the migrants knew they would be taken to that state.
